In Russia, starting in February 2026, morphine will be available for anesthetic care to patients with a new, more effective method of administration — into the spinal canal. This was reported to Izvestia by the press service of the manufacturer of the drug, FSUE Endopharm (Moscow Endocrine Plant). According to doctors, the new method of using the drug will help to relieve severe pain that could not be relieved by other drugs. Experts note that the range of pharmaceutical forms of narcotic analgesics in Russia is developing slowly, so they called the appearance of a new version of the painkiller a big plus.

A new method of using morphine

The first batches of morphine, which can be injected intrathecally into the cerebrospinal fluid, have been released onto the Russian market. More than 150 thousand packages were produced, FSUE Endopharm (Moscow Endocrine Plant, overseen by the Ministry of Industry and Trade) told Izvestia. The launch into civil circulation is scheduled for February 2026.

The method of drug delivery directly into the spinal canal, when the drug enters the cerebrospinal fluid, allows achieving a powerful and persistent analgesic effect at a lower dose and significantly reducing systemic side effects, Denis Protsenko, director of the MMCC Kommunarka, chief freelance specialist in anesthesiology and intensive care at the Moscow City Department of Health, explained to Izvestia.

The expert clarified that this method of administration is used to help patients with severe chronic pain that cannot be relieved by other methods and to perform spinal anesthesia during surgical operations. He called the emergence of intrathecal morphine "sovereignty in pain therapy."

"We are moving away from dependence on imports in one of the most sensitive areas,— Denis Protsenko said. — Patients with cancer and other serious diseases will receive a long-awaited effective tool to combat pain.

Efim Shifman, President of the Association of Obstetric Anesthesiologists and Intensive Care Physicians, Vice—President of the Federation of Anesthesiologists and Intensive Care Physicians, listed the advantages of the intrathecal method of administration of the drug - fast effect, long-lasting effect and reduction in the frequency of injections.

"This is relevant for many types of pathologies that are accompanied by a long recovery period," he said.

In addition, the drug can be administered intravenously, intramuscularly, subcutaneously, epidurally in the treatment of persistent pain syndrome, acute forms of coronary heart disease, preoperative and postoperative periods, respiratory failure, as well as for anesthetic support of cesarean section surgery when performing neuroaxial anesthesia methods.

Earlier, together with the expert medical community, Endopharm worked out and amended the instructions for use of the drug "Morphine, solution for injection 10 mg/ ml" — a new method of administration was added there. The drug appeared as part of the implementation of the State Strategy for the Development of Healthcare for the period up to 2030" (approved on December 8, 2025).

How the new method works

Morphine as a component of opium is considered one of the oldest drugs used by mankind, said Olga Kirsanova, an oncologist and senior researcher at the Herzen Moscow Research Institute of Oncology (branch of the National Research Medical Center of Radiology).

— The latest medical achievement in this area was the invention of the intrathecal method of morphine administration. It allows you to deliver an analgesic directly to the pain pathways in the spinal cord, which opens up new opportunities for doctors. The dose of morphine for intrathecal administration is one hundred times less, and the effectiveness of anesthesia is higher," the scientist clarified.

Today in Russia, three clinics have mastered the method of intrathecal administration. The latest change in the instructions for the drug will allow spreading this experience throughout the country, increasing the number of medical institutions that will be able to use this method of treating chronic pain.

—The specialists of the P.A. Herzen Moscow Institute of Medical Sciences are confident that in situations where the cause of chronic pain cannot be eliminated, intrathecal opioid therapy becomes one of the most effective and safe options for patient care," said Olga Kirsanova.

The range of medicinal forms of such analgesics in Russia is developing extremely slowly, and they are still insufficient for the needs of modern medicine, said Nikolai Bespalov, Director of Development at RNC Pharma, an analytical company.

According to him, in 2025, the Russian market received almost 12 million packages of drugs from this group of analgesics.

— This is 1% less than in 2024, before that, this market segment had been steadily growing for four consecutive years, in particular, 12.1 million packages were delivered in 2024, which is 15.6% more than in 2023. So a 1% drop is very conditional here," the expert pointed out.

According to him, domestic manufacturers have always played a major role in this group, which is due to the peculiarities of the regulatory treatment of such drugs. The main role in the group is played by tramadol drugs — in total they form about 81% of the volume.

Morphine drugs account for 6% of the market. Up to and including 2019, the Austrian pharmaceutical company Mundipharma supplied a tablet form of the drug to Russia, but starting in 2020, the Moscow Endocrine Plant remained its only supplier.
